The First Hole
This is my friend Jack in his stock 96 Ford Explorer. His truck
really looks good going through mud. He went through this hole first and didn't even check
to see how deep it is. This is not a good idea, but he knew if he got stuck I would pull
him out with ease. Did I mention that his truck is 2 wheel drive. Just a note to the
novice to not go off the beaten path with out a phone or with a friend that can pull you
out, this will come in handy. (Believe me I know from experience)
This is me in my stock white 94
Full-Size Bronco (a.k.a. O.J.). It doesn't look as good as when Jack went through it but I
had fun going through it. I used my 4 wheel drive going through it just incase, cause I
knew Jack couldn't pull me out if I got stuck. Its always better to be safe than sorry.
The Second Hole
We found this hole later on that
same day and we didn't know what to think about it. So first we tried to find out how deep
it was and we could only tell that it wasn't more than a foot for the first 10 feet and
after that we just assumed that it stayed the same. (I know what you are thinking) But
Jack wanted to go through it badly, I couldn't go through it because I didn't have a
rescue vehicle on hand. But I could easily pull Jack out so he decided to go for it. And
from what you can tell from the pictures he made it, but I was very worried that I
wouldn't be able to pull him out, but I didn't have to and we got these great pictures of
it.
